Autonomous Driving - Systems Integration Engineer

Robert Bosch   •  

Sunnyvale, CA

Industry: Professional, Scientific & Technical Services


Less than 5 years

Posted 47 days ago

Job Description

  • System integration of connected, fully automated Robocars, including piloting (first introduction) for mass production
  • Coordination and execution of software and hardware integration in close collaboration with functional development teams
  • Development and improvement of continuous integration, testing and deployment infrastructure using the latest technology advancements
  • Ensuring high quality system software releases being test-worthy in real world environments


Basic Qualifications:

Masters’ Degree in Robotics, Mechatronics or Computer Science

2+ years experience in Systems Engineering focusing on systems integration and software development

2+ years experience using Linux, C/C++ and Python

Preferred Qualifications:

2+ years experience in software development and its processes including:

  • Version control mechanisms like Git or Mercurial
  • Build systems with package & dependency management like CMake
  • Software testing automation tools like Jenkins or Bamboo

2+ years scriptingexperience in Bash and/or Ansible

1+ years experience in software frameworks like ROS

1+ years experience in embedded systems development

Additional Information

BOSCH is a proud supporter of STEM (Science, Technology, Engineering & Mathematics) Initiatives

  • FIRST Robotics (For Inspiration and Recognition of Science and Technology)
  • AWIM (A World In Motion)